Output 26b54ca7b5d7c56aea5fcc2126c192eea8f92fecb00f8abacb9431595299595e:0

value
577800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d8c9dc649955c5a2240103f84d0e372a8f42d0e OP_EQUALVERIFY OP_CHECKSIG
address
159qrpq8pLRWbnqt6AzAKjfASK4mT3kFdB
transaction
26b54ca7b5d7c56aea5fcc2126c192eea8f92fecb00f8abacb9431595299595e
spent
true